Overview: The R&D Formulator has responsibilities for the design, development, testing and implementation of new topical skin care formulations from initial concept through production; troubleshooting/resolving, adjusting or reformulating existing formulas as needed. R&D activities support all areas of the organization as illustrated by the responsibilities below. The position heavily emphasizes laboratory work, but also includes significant interaction with Operations, Quality Assurance, Purchasing, Sales & Marketing, and Business Development. The ideal candidate will have a good understanding of the entire product development cycle, and cGMP experience in an FDA regulated environment is preferred.
Major Duties & Responsibilities
• Develop new products and assays to meet Sales and/or customer requirement per assigned projects
• Conduct pre-formulation/formulation studies including solubility, excipient compatibility, accelerated stability, physical characterization, and proof of concept batches
• Actively prioritize multiple projects/workload, effectively anticipate/manage resource gaps, and deliver on agreed-to timelines
• Prepare protocols for stability testing
• Accurately record raw data and analyze, as well as calculate and interpret the results
• Determine product shelf life through stability testing and data analysis
• Ensure stability and efficacy according to project requirements
• Participate in the writing of protocols, development reports, and manufacturing batch records for development batches
• Create and approve design specifications for new products
• Troubleshoot product/process issues and participate in investigations related to product quality issues
• Aid manufacturing in the production of new products (scale up)
• Create Master Batch records
• Ensure documentation created is in compliance with cGMP standards
• Compile and maintain a formulation library of reoccurring products
• Enhance existing product formulations as directed
• Prepare samples for customer evaluation or for use by Sales & Marketing, QC/QA
• Establish relationships with material suppliers and vendors
• Research new products and chemicals for new business opportunities
• Conduct ongoing competitor product and technology assessments for assigned categories to ensure understanding of the latest developments in relevant product categories
• Read and understand SDSs for all raw materials that are used, and create SDSs for new products
